Eastwood/Jolie Teaming for Changeling
Universal Pictures and Imagine Entertainment are fast-tracking The Changeling with Clint Eastwood looking to direct and Angelina Jolie in talks to star.
In the movie, Jolie would play a woman whose son is abducted but retrieved. However, she suspects that the returned child is not hers. She must then confront corruption in the LAPD. The story is based on true events in 1920s Los Angeles. J. Michael Straczynski wrote the script. Brian Grazer and Ron Howard will produce. Production will likely start later this year.
Jolie stars later this year in A Mighty Heart and in Beowulf for director Robert Zemeckis. She is also scheduled to star in an adaptation of the Ayn Rand classic Atlas Shrugged.
